Transverse cervicopertrochanteric hip fracture.
J G Gamble1, J Lettice, J T Smith
1Division of Orthopaedic Surgery, Stanford University School of Medicine, California.
Journal of Pediatric Orthopedics
|November 1, 1991
Summary
A rare transverse hip fracture in a young child was successfully treated with skeletal traction and spica casting. Follow-up showed excellent bone healing and normal hip development without complications.

Background:
- Hip fractures are uncommon in young children.
- Transverse hip fractures involving multiple regions are exceptionally rare.
- Optimal management strategies for complex pediatric hip fractures require further investigation.
Observation:
- A 3-year-old boy presented with a unique transverse hip fracture affecting the cervical, cervicotrochanteric, and intertrochanteric areas.
- The fracture pattern was previously undescribed in pediatric literature.
- Treatment involved 4 weeks of skeletal traction followed by spica cast immobilization.
Findings:
- The treatment resulted in successful fracture healing.
- A 3-year follow-up revealed satisfactory growth and remodeling of the proximal femur.
- No signs of osteonecrosis, premature physeal closure, or coxa vara were observed.
Implications:
- This case demonstrates the efficacy of skeletal traction and spica casting for complex pediatric hip fractures.
- Early and appropriate management can lead to excellent long-term outcomes in pediatric hip fractures.
- Further research into rare pediatric hip fracture patterns and their management is warranted.
